				README.md
			
		
		
			
			
		
	
	lws minimal MQTT client
The application connects to a broker at localhost 1883 (unencrypted) or 8883 (tls)
build
 $ cmake . && make
usage
| Commandline option | Meaning | 
|---|---|
| -d | Debug verbosity in decimal, eg, -d15 | 
| -s | Use tls and connect to port 8883 instead of 1883 | 
Start mosquitto server locally
$ mosquitto
Run the example
[2020/01/31 10:40:23:7789] U: LWS minimal MQTT client unencrypted [-d<verbosity>][-s]
[2020/01/31 10:40:23:8539] N: lws_mqtt_generate_id: User space provided a client ID 'lwsMqttClient'
[2020/01/31 10:40:23:9893] N: _lws_mqtt_rx_parser: migrated nwsi 0x50febd0 to sid 1 0x5106820
[2020/01/31 10:40:23:9899] U: callback_mqtt: MQTT_CLIENT_ESTABLISHED
[2020/01/31 10:40:23:9967] U: callback_mqtt: WRITEABLE: Subscribing
[2020/01/31 10:40:24:0068] U: callback_mqtt: MQTT_SUBSCRIBED
Send something to the test client
mosquitto_pub -h 127.0.0.1 -p 1883 -t test/topic0 -m "hello"
Observe it received at the test client
[2020/01/31 10:40:27:1845] U: callback_mqtt: MQTT_CLIENT_RX
